Mercedes scoop fastest pit stop award in Singapore
Mercedes made their weekend at the Singapore Grand Prix perfect with first place for Lewis Hamilton and third place for Valtteri Bottas. The team rounded off their strong performance with a one-two win in the DHL Fastest Pit Stop Award. The Silver Arrows pit crew completed the two fastest tire changes of the race just as they had done two weeks ago in Monza. Race winner Lewis Hamilton made his only pit stop on lap 29 during the longest race of the year. The switch from intermediate to ultrasoft tires took only 2.27 seconds – the fastest swap in Singapore. On the previous lap, Mercedes had bolted on slicks for Valtteri Bottas in 2.40 seconds, thus demonstrating faultless teamwork...
